Ciągle mam problemy z polskimi ogonkami, tym razem w AJAXsie... Gdy przekazuję przezeń jakiś string z polskimi ogonkami, nic nie działa w IE.
Używam metody GET.
Strony są nagrywane w utf-8, w firefoxie wszystko jest OK.
Jedyne co pomaga, to użycie czegoś takiego:
[PHP] pobierz, plaintext
- $str=iconv('ISO-8859-2', 'utf-8', $str);//$str to string przekazany via Ajax
Tyle tylko, że to nie działa znowu w FF. No coś myślę, że popełniam jakiś prosty błąd, bo nie wierzę żeby normalni ludzie miewali takie problemy...
Edit:
Na stronie wywołującej ajax mam zdefiniowane: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> a potem w meta tagach: <meta http-equiv="Content-Type" content="text/html; charset=utf-8">
Na stronie wywoływanej nie mam nic z tych rzeczy.